MahaDBT 1.0 Deadline Alert: Urgent Steps to Secure Your Scholarship Before Portal Closes Today

Lakhs of Maharashtra students risk delays if MahaDBT 1.0 closes unchecked today, September 18. The window ran only for pending cases from September 10 to 18. The official note says, “will remain active from 10 September to 18 September 2026.” Prioritise verification now to avoid instalment holds for AY 2023–24 to 2025–26.

Who is affected today? Students whose forms show pending at institute, district, or bank stages. Cases with Aadhaar or bank mismatches also need fixes. Re-apply on 1.0 is disabled for sent-back applications. Those will reopen on MahaDBT 2.0 after migration, per the portal’s notice.

MahaDBT 1.0 final checks: what to do before closure

Login and open Application Status. Confirm scheme, year, and beneficiary details match documents. Re-check name order, date of birth, and category fields. Upload clear, recent scans where pages were rejected. Save and resubmit to your institute desk. Take screenshots of status and acknowledgements for records and grievance follow‑up.

Bank and Aadhaar fixes students can complete today

Confirm your bank account is active and Aadhaar-seeded. Ask your branch to update eKYC, mobile number, and NPCI mapping if needed. Verify IFSC after mergers. Avoid joint or minor accounts for scholarships. Re-enter account number carefully, then refresh status on the portal after the bank confirms updates.

Institute and District Nodal Officer verification: how to nudge approvals

Visit your college scholarship desk with fee receipt, bonafide, and attendance proof. Request forwarding from Institute to District Nodal Officer the same day. Keep the principal’s seal visible on uploads. If desks show “reverted,” correct remarks and resubmit immediately. Note the officer’s window hours and keep stamped acknowledgements.

If status still shows pending after today

Once today’s window ends, 1.0 activity pauses and data migrates. Verified cases should progress to payment when treasury cycles run. Sent‑back applications will surface on MahaDBT 2.0 for re-apply with corrections. Track your status regularly and retain all receipts for any future grievance filing.

MahaDBT 2.0 migration: what changes for upcoming applications

Fresh and upcoming cycles are moving to MahaDBT 2.0, with departments announcing starts on the new portal. Expect re-registration prompts, updated forms, and renewed document standards. Keep soft copies ready, and monitor institute instructions for desk mapping on 2.0. Act today on 1.0, then shift attention to 2.0 timelines.
